A wonderful stay in the quiet side of central Siena. Perfectly located on a quiet street only minutes from the busy historic central. A beautiful old building, quiet, cool, refined. No luxuries just simple accommodation done very well. Helpful attentive staff, parking available behind the hotel (you need to drive to the hotel main entrance then pass your vehicle registration details to the front desk so the police don't issue a fine then drive back around to the street with the car park, but leaving your luggage in reception to avoid carrying it up the several flights of steps between the car park and the hotel rear entrance). Breakfast was simple but ample for most people's needs. The coffee wasn't good, better to head to a nearby bar for a proper cappuccino or espresso. The terraced garden is a wonderful quiet space with shade for relaxing and taking in the view. Garden side room get to also enjoy the beautiful Tuscan views. The guest room was spacious and quiet. WiFi is generally fast enough for streaming. The TVs are relatively small, and without USB ports. The hotel is only wheelchair accessible from the street; the car park is via several flights of stairs. Rooms facing the street can be noisy during business hours.

About Siena
City in Italy

Siena is a city in Tuscany, Italy. It is the capital of the province of Siena. Siena is the 12th largest city in the region by number of inhabitants, with a population of 53,062 as of 2022. source
